PDA

View Full Version : قسمت اعشاری



Roozbeh
سه شنبه 20 دی 1384, 20:58 عصر
سلام.
1)دستورات گرفتن قسمت اعشاری یک متغییر و بلعکس گرفتن قسمت صحیح یک متغییر رو اگه کسی میدونه لطفا به من بگه.
ممنونم

pedram1355
شنبه 24 دی 1384, 08:03 صبح
شما میتونید متغییر رو به صورت char وارد کنید ورودی های قبل از (. ) قسمت صحیح و بعد از آن اعشاری میباشند .

Marine
شنبه 24 دی 1384, 15:12 عصر
سلام.
1)دستورات گرفتن قسمت اعشاری یک متغییر و بلعکس گرفتن قسمت صحیح یک متغییر رو اگه کسی میدونه لطفا به من بگه.
ممنونم


float f=17.3;


قسمت صحیح :


int(f);

قسمت اعشاری :


f-int(f);

seyedof
یک شنبه 25 دی 1384, 07:12 صبح
سلام
خود سی تابع ریاضی به اسم floor داره که در واقع همون تابع کف در ریاضی است و جزء صحیح عدد رو برمیگردونه. برای یافتن قسمت اعشاری باید خود عدد رو منهای floor اوون بکنید.
در ویژوال سی floorf هم هست که برای کار با اعداد float می باشد.
ممنون علی